Working Principles

The UC3825DWTRG4 is a voltage-mode PWM controller that regulates and controls the output voltage of power supplies. It operates by comparing the feedback voltage (FB) with a reference voltage (VREF) to generate an error signal. This error signal is amplified by the error amplifier (COMP) and used to adjust the duty cycle of the PWM signal.

By adjusting the timing resistor (RT) and timing capacitor (CT), the frequency and duty cycle of the PWM signal can be set according to the desired application requirements. The soft-start feature allows for a gradual increase in the output voltage during startup, while the tracking feature enables synchronization with another power supply.

The UC3825DWTRG4 also incorporates various protection features such as overcurrent protection, under-voltage lockout, and thermal shutdown. These safeguards ensure the reliable operation of the power supply and protect it from potential damage.
